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85 84 791
5540512 99244283 9088
5540512 99244283 9088
672 4559964 7116
All about undefined
Interested in learning more?
5540512 99244283 9088
672 4559964 7116
See more
29401903203 19 78659431307
73539678213 609 7460 933
See more
41793 92488858 49854
97997 080933653 8811974 1549
See more